Transaction c59f68f24b0ace6f72abeb374a829dda91716a3a65d4e24e2d6a26e949c6a6b2

block
6ad5f564dcf4ee56e5ff478c43cb720f436498d5caa837ab5412447669fbcbe1

18 Inputs

2 Outputs